Investment titan Neuberger Berman has massively exceeded its original fundraising target, closing its second GP-led secondary fund at a whopping $4 billion.

In an impressive display of capital gathering, Neuberger Berman has closed its GP-led secondary fund, NB Strategic Capital Fund II, at an overwhelming $4 billion. This achievement is a significant step up from the fund’s initial target of $2.5 billion and is a fourfold increase in size from its predecessor, which itself raised a respectable $955 million last year. The firm also managed to scrap together additional capital for co-investment purposes alongside the new fund.

These efforts tap into a sustained appetite within the investor community for continuation vehicles. These tools allow investors to hold onto their assets for longer periods, while simultaneously helping generate liquidity for their limited partners (LPs). With over 40 single and multi-asset continuation fund transactions under its belt, Neuberger Berman has mobilised $15 billion in total transaction value.
